Are you vulnerable to HIV, interested in taking PrEP or need HIV testing? The AIDS Foundation of Chicago and Center on Halsted can help with emergency financial assistance (rent, utility payments) for people who are living with HIV and who are HIV-negative and taking PrEP. We can connect people vulnerable to HIV to PrEP, HIV testing, medical care and more. Call the HIV Resource Hub at 1-844-HUB-4040. Services are available in Chicago, Cook County and the Collar Counties (Chicago Metropolitan Area). Learn more about the Hub and services available here.
